Lean Manufacturing Techniques And Tools For Businesses

If you are a manufacturer, chances are you must have heard the term lean manufacturing. In case you do not know what is lean manufacturing, you must learn this here in this article. According to the lean manufacturing definition as illustrated in business books, it is a management philosophy of the optimal production of goods. It is based on some lean manufacturing techniques and lean manufacturing principles that focus on the removal of waste and the implementation of the flow in a production process.

Here is a look at some of the popular lean manufacturing techniques and tools.

Quality function deployment or QFD is a popular technique of lean manufacturing. It focuses on identifying the outputs demanded by the customers. The technique helps you to trace these outputs to causal inputs like product design and manufacturing process which you can easily control. This primarily helps in quality planning.

Another popular technique is workplace organization and visual management. It focuses on the 30 second rule that helps you make your workplace so organized that anyone can find anything within 30 seconds. It focuses on workplace organization by sorting things and setting them in order. Also it removes things which are not used regularly. It stresses on the employment of shadow boards, area boundaries, signs and labels in your workplace to help find things which can be easily used.

Then there is the process failure mode and effects analysis technique. This technique helps you to assess the size of the relative risks in the manufacturing process. It also helps you to list all types of potential sources of failure. After that it lets you allocate a weighted points score based on the expected frequency of failure, the chances to detect the failure and the severity of the consequences. It also lets you be sure about the evolution of manufacturing failure modes.

The next technique is poka yoke or fool-proofing. It is a cost-effective lean manufacturing technique that helps to prevent the production of any type of defective product. Then there is the statistical process control technique. It facilitates the establishment of the limits of statistical variability for the output parameter of a system. This means that under normal conditions whenever the output variable goes above the upper control limit or falls below the lower control limit you can stop the process and take a remedial action.
